开门见山的说
目录
面对对象编程有三大思想
封装,继承,多态
今天我们就来了解一下封装
什么是封装?
将数据与操作数据的方法进行结合,隐藏对象的属性和实现细节,仅对外公开接口实现对象交互
不想让其他(类)看见该功能语句实现的具体过程,
通过java的技术手段讲这些细节进行封装;
仅仅对外提供一些公开的接口,实现功能的交互。
对于使用这个类的人来说,只需要关心公开的接口如何交互就可以了
封装的关键词
private 只有自己知道,其他人都不知道
default 对于自己家族中(同一个包中)可以访问,对于其他人来说就是隐私了
protected 主要是用在继承中
public 可以理解为一个人的外貌特征,谁都可以看得到,公开透明的
当我们指定一个类,什么都不写时会默认default权限
但用default修饰时却会报错
private修饰后在其他类不能被调用
我们只能通过类内部方法访问到 private 修饰的成员变量
哈,谢谢各位同志的阅读,然后呢如果觉得本文对您有所帮助的话,还给个免费的赞吧
Thanks♪(・ω・)ノ